- Abstract
- Over the past decade visualization and analysis of geospatial data followed the general
trend in information technology from monolithic desktop applications towards loosely
coupled Web Services. In order to achieve interoperability among these services standard interfaces are required. The standards and specifications published by the Open
Geospatial Consortium (OGC) and the International Organization for Standardization
(ISO) form the basic set on which such service-oriented architectures (SOA) can be
build. With respect to online data visualization a map like representation of spatial
content has found widespread use, especially as part of Spatial Data Infrastructures
(SDI). In combination with metadata catalogues the primary aim of these map services is data publication and distribution, hence the capabilities are limited to viewing
or browsing (e.g. zoom, pan, identify). Only a few examples exist enabling users to
analyse data (e.g. calculating statistics or merging different data layers) through a web
interface or Web Service. In this paper first results are presented from research conducted on the implementation of a OGC Web Processing Service (WPS) for online
analysis of Earth observation time series data. Earth observation data at regional to
global scale has been collected with various sensors and satellite systems for more
than three decades. The amounts of data acquired seem to have outpaced our ability to
exploit and analysis it. With aid of consistent data products (e.g. MODIS suite of land
surface products) and the advancements in information technology and in particular
